Vent Rerouting
This is where our South Bel Air expertise pays off. Long vent runs from detached workshops or poorly placed laundry rooms are a leading cause of repeated blockages and dryer inefficiency. We reroute vents to shorten the path, reduce bends, and eliminate the sagging flex duct that traps lint. A reroute in South Bel Air typically costs $275-$450 depending on material length, wall or roof penetration, and whether we’re relocating the dryer connection or the exterior termination. We use smooth-wall aluminum, not flex, and we secure it with proper supports so it doesn’t collapse under its own weight. Common Dryer Vent Cleaning Problems We See in South Bel Air Homes
- Long vent runs from detached workshops and outbuildings. South Bel Air’s acreage properties often place the laundry facility in a detached structure, requiring vent runs of 25 to 40 feet or more. These extended runs lose airflow velocity, allowing lint to settle and accumulate in low spots and bends that standard cleaning cannot fully clear.
- Collapsed or kinked flex duct in unconditioned spaces. The flex duct installed in South Bel Air’s 1960s-1980s construction was never meant to last forty years. In workshops and crawl spaces, age, moisture from Harford County’s humid summers, and rodent activity combine to collapse or separate duct at the boot connections. Cleaning alone won’t fix it; replacement with rigid or smooth-wall aluminum is required.
- DIY cleaning attempts that worsen the problem. Self-reliant South Bel Air homeowners often attempt lint removal with leaf blowers, shop vacs, or brush kits from the hardware store. These methods frequently compact lint deeper into the run, damage fragile connections, or dislodge duct sections without the homeowner realizing. We arrive to find the original blockage plus new damage that requires repair.
- Bird and rodent nesting in unprotected vents. The rural setting around South Bel Air means active wildlife populations. A missing bird guard or cracked vent cap allows nesting material to accumulate rapidly, sometimes completely blocking airflow and creating a genuine fire hazard.
